At age seven, Miss Sassoon began he...view moreJANET SASSOON has had two careers,
fi rst as a ballerina with an international
reputation and now as a classical dance
teacher and coach in international
demand.
At age seven, Miss Sassoon began her
training with the San Francisco Ballet.
By age ten, Miss Sassoon was performing
in roles with the San Francisco Opera
and Ballet companies. At fi fteen, she
moved to Paris to continue her studies
with Leo Staats, Lubov Egorova,
Olga Preobrajenska, and Mathilde
Kschessinska. Miss Sassoon joined the
internationally renowned Grand Ballet
du Marquis de Cuevas as one of its
youngest soloists.
Returning to America, she danced in
guest appearances with the Chicago
and Utah Ballets as well with the San
Francisco Ballet. She joined the Berlin
Ballet as prima ballerina touring Europe
with the company.
Miss Sassoon earned a reputation as one
of Europe’s leading dramatic ballerinas.
She also toured with the company
throughout Europe, South America, and
